The gathering financial crisis has begun biting into the world arts scene. Metropolitan Opera has slashed its once-mighty endowment of more than $300 million by a third. Broadway closed half its shows in January, including the popular Hairspray, Spamalot, Young Frankenstein and Spring Awakening, in the wake of falling ticket sales. But what is the outlook for show business in China in 2009?
